Achievements and awards. The program underwent state accreditation in 2020 and professional-public accreditation (the Association for Engineering Education in Russia) in 2017. This program is marked with the European quality label EUR-ACE.

Students are participants of the annual UMNIK contest; the annual International scientific conference of students, postgraduate students and young scientists “Perspektiva (Prospect);”

the open selective university championship “Young Professionals (WorldSkills Russia)” in the competencies: Engineering CAD Design; Prototyping; etc.

Teaching staff. The academic degree holders ratio is 77%. The department employs four Doctors of Sciences. The representatives of top regional machine building enterprises are engaged in the development and implementation of the educational program.

Facilities and resources. NCFU has four learning and research laboratories with state-of-the-art equipment, the research center for reliability and strength of materials and the laboratory of the inter-institute resource center for 3D-modeling and prototyping.

Research. The research areas: use of neural networks in production processes; volumetric pulsed laser hardening of materials; lifetime improvement of high-load compression springs, etc.

Education. Active and interactive teaching models, distance education technologies are used. Students have access to the following electronic library systems: University Library ONLINE; IPRbooks; Biblio-online.ru.

Strategic partners. Industrial enterprises: Signal, Stavropol Piston Ring Factory – Stapri, Neptune, Stavropol Machine Tool Works, Elektroavtomatika, etc.; companies ASCON and Autodesk CIS, top manufacturers of CAD, simulation and computer-generated graphics systems.

International projects and programs. Students participate in academic mobility programs: DAAD (Germany), GE4 (France, Spain, Austria, Malaysia, etc.), national scholarship programs of Slovakia, Hungary, the Czech Republic, Slovenia, Norway.

Competitive advantages. Graduates can carry out the following activities: design and engineering and research activities using CAD technologies; engineering and manufacturing activities using state-of-the-art CAM/CAPP technologies; organizational and management activities based on PDM systems; operational activity using CALS technologies.
